Fuzzy logic is an extension of the classical (Boolean) logic that can be used to handle mathematically the vagueness of human linguistics and thinking (Tanaka, 1996). In other words, it provides a logical system to formalize approximate reasoning (Zedeh, 1994; 1996). Fuzzy logic, according to Lotfi Zadeh, can be broadly considered as the union of fuzzified crisp logics. Its primary aim is to provide a formal, computationally oriented system of concepts and techniques for dealing with modes of reasoning that are approximate rather than exact.
